In a Quality of Earnings (QoE) report, add-backs are normalization adjustments that strip away non-operational or one-time expenses to reveal a company’s clean, recurring EBITDA. These adjustments are essential for uncovering the sustainable earning power of a mid-market business.
According to Zaidwood Capital, common add-back categories include:
- Owner’s Compensation Adjustments: This aligns above-market owner salaries and benefits with industry-standard rates for replacement managers. For example, if an owner pays themselves $600,000 but the market rate for a general manager is $200,000, the $400,000 difference is added back.
- Non-Recurring Expenses: These are one-time costs unlikely to repeat after the acquisition, such as one-time legal fees from a specific litigation matter, consulting engagements, relocation costs, or restructuring charges.
- Personal Expenses: These involve costs unrelated to business operations that are run through the company, including personal travel, entertainment, luxury vehicles, or family members on the payroll who are not active in the business.
- Related-Party Transactions: This includes expenses like above-market rent or management fees paid to entities owned by the seller. For instance, if a company pays $30,000 in monthly rent to a seller-owned LLC when the market rate is only $15,000, the excess is treated as an add-back.
